Frequently Asked Questions about Landis

What type of rentals are currently available in Landis?

There are currently 53 Apartments for Rent in Landis, NC with pricing that ranges from $400 to $3,389. There are also 47 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Landis ranging from $850 to $2,700.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Landis?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Landis ranges from $850 to $2,700 with an average monthly rent of $1,742.
